Steuben COVID-19 cases show significant drop

ANGOLA — In just two weeks, Steuben County’s positive COVID-19 cases have dropped by about 50%, said a report released Wednesday by the Steuben County Health Department. In the most recent demographic report, Steuben County registered 105 new cases for the seven-day period ending Wednesday. That compares to the one-week period ending Jan. 6 when there were 219 new cases. Last week’s report showed 175 new cases, which was the first time in two months that there were less than 200 new cases in a week. Deaths continue to mount at a steady pace at a time when other counties in the area are seeing a decline.

Health Department transitioning into the COVID-19 vaccination business

CROOKED LAKE — COVID-19 vaccinations of people 80 and older from Steuben County has begun in earnest at the Steuben County Event Center in the Steuben County Park. Vaccinations started for that age group on Monday. On Tuesday, the Steuben County Health Department was starting to work in concert with Cameron Memorial Community Hospital, which continues to be the lead agency running the clinic. “We couldn’t have asked for a better partner than Cameron,” said Alicia Walsh, administrator of the Steuben County Health Department. The vaccination clinic was set up by Cameron in December as vaccines started being made available, first for health care workers. The first inoculations started on Dec. 18 and as many as 300-plus people have been vaccinated a day.
